The Use of Cartoons as Popular Culture Imagery During Wartime
Cartoons and comic books reached an apex in popularity during World War II, far outselling more “serious” entertainment magazines of the day, such as Life, Look and Time. The value and significance of cartoons, both artistic and educational, as well as how they were used in propaganda, will be discussed using numerous illustrations taken from the 1940’s (the golden age of comics) and beyond.
